Pole beans are climbing varieties of green beans that produce over a much longer season than bush types. They require trellising but yield more per square foot.
In Zone 8a, the average last spring frost is around March 8 and the first fall frost is around November 18, giving you a growing season of approximately 255 days.

Pole Beans Planting Calendar — Zone 8a
| Activity | When | Date Range |
|---|---|---|
| Start Indoors | January 18 | Jan 18 – Feb 1 |
| Transplant Outdoors | March 22 | Mar 22 – Apr 5 |
| Direct Sow | March 15 | Mar 15 – Apr 5 |
| Harvest | May 17 | May 17 – Jul 12 |
Plant 1" deep · 15" apart · Rows 24" apart

Growing Tips for Pole Beans in Zone
Zone has a short growing season (~255 days). Start Pole Beans indoors early and use season-extension techniques like row covers and cold frames.
Provide sturdy 6-8 foot poles, tepees, or trellises. Direct sow after last frost. Pick regularly to encourage continued production. Beans fix nitrogen benefiting following crops.

Frequently Asked Questions
When should I plant Pole Beans in Zone 8a?
In Zone 8a, plan your Pole Beans planting around the average last frost date of March 8. Start seeds indoors around January 18. Direct sow outdoors around March 15. Transplant seedlings around March 22.
Can Pole Beans grow in Zone 8a?
Yes, Pole Beans can grow well in Zone 8a, hardy in USDA zones 3a through 11b. Zone 8a has a growing season of approximately 255 days, which is sufficient for Pole Beans (55-70 days to maturity).
When can I harvest Pole Beans in Zone 8a?
In Zone 8a, expect to harvest Pole Beans from May 17 – July 12. Pole Beans takes 55-70 days from planting to harvest.
What is the last frost date for Zone 8a?
The average last spring frost in Zone 8a is around March 8, and the first fall frost is around November 18. This gives a growing season of approximately 255 days. These are 50% probability dates — actual frost dates vary year to year.
What should I plant next to Pole Beans?
Good companion plants for Pole Beans include Corn, Squash Summer, Carrots. These companions can help with pest control, pollination, and nutrient sharing.
